Sarcomatoid mesothelioma, an aggressive subtype of asbestos-related cancer, presents significant challenges in both diagnosis and treatment. This rare form accounts for 10-20% of all mesothelioma cases, with a notably poor survival rate. The median life expectancy for patients diagnosed with sarcomatoid mesothelioma is a mere 4-7 months, with only 15% surviving two years and a dismal 5% reaching the five-year mark. These statistics underscore the urgent need for improved understanding and management of this disease.
The incidence of mesothelioma, including the sarcomatoid subtype, has been steadily rising due to historical asbestos use in various industries until the 1980s. The latency period between asbestos exposure and disease onset can span 20-60 years, complicating early detection efforts. Sarcomatoid mesothelioma is characterized by spindle-shaped cells that are difficult to differentiate from benign tissue, further hindering timely diagnosis.
Recent advancements in diagnostic techniques, such as immunohistochemical analysis using markers like podoplanin and calretinin, have improved the accuracy of identifying this subtype. However, the aggressive nature of sarcomatoid mesothelioma continues to pose significant treatment challenges. Current treatment modalities primarily involve a multimodal approach combining surgery, chemotherapy, and radiation therapy. Standard chemotherapy regimens, including pemetrexed combined with cisplatin, yield a median survival of approximately 15 months, which is still considerably lower than other mesothelioma subtypes.

Current State of Sarcomatoid Mesothelioma
Recent data indicates a concerning trend in mesothelioma cases, with sarcomatoid mesothelioma presenting the most unfavorable prognosis. The American Cancer Society reports a steady increase in mesothelioma incidence, reflecting the long latency period associated with asbestos exposure. Sarcomatoid mesothelioma, accounting for 10-20% of all cases, poses unique challenges due to its aggressive nature and resistance to conventional treatments.
Current treatment modalities primarily involve a multimodal approach:
- Surgery: Extrapleural pneumonectomy or pleurectomy/decortication
- Chemotherapy: Standard regimens using pemetrexed and cisplatin
- Radiation therapy: Often used in combination with surgery
Despite these interventions, the survival rate remains low. Patients receiving treatment have a median survival of approximately 15 months, significantly lower than other mesothelioma subtypes. The five-year survival rate stands at a mere 5%, underscoring the urgent need for more effective treatment strategies.

Challenges in Addressing Sarcomatoid Mesothelioma
Major challenges include:
- Late-stage diagnosis: Non-specific symptoms and diagnostic difficulties lead to 70-80% of cases being diagnosed at advanced stages
- Treatment resistance: Sarcomatoid cells show higher resistance to conventional therapies compared to other subtypes
- Limited understanding: Molecular mechanisms driving its aggressive behavior remain poorly understood
- Clinical trial scarcity: Only 5-10% of mesothelioma clinical trials specifically target the sarcomatoid subtype
- Psychological impact: Poor prognosis significantly affects patient mental health and treatment adherence
Future Directions in Sarcomatoid Mesothelioma Research and Treatment
Emerging research focuses on improving outcomes for sarcomatoid mesothelioma patients:
- Immunotherapy: Recent trials with Nivolumab and Ipilimumab show potential in improving survival rates by up to 25%
- Targeted therapies: Studies investigating genetic and molecular profiles aim to develop personalized treatment strategies
- Novel surgical techniques: Advancements in minimally invasive procedures seek to improve post-operative recovery and quality of life
- Early detection methods: Research into blood-based biomarkers and advanced imaging techniques may facilitate earlier diagnosis, potentially improving survival rates by 50% if caught at stage I
- Combination therapies: Exploring synergistic effects of multiple treatment modalities to enhance overall efficacy, with some studies showing up to 30% improvement in response rates
These advancements offer hope for improved sarcomatoid mesothelioma survival rates in the future, emphasizing the critical need for continued research and clinical trials in this challenging field of oncology.
